Output title

Detection of Deformable Structures in Video by Polynomial Fitting Using an Efficient Hough Transform

Additional information

<26> This paper presents a novel formulation of the Hough Transform that enables this technique to be applied for more complex shapes, whilst still being computationally efficient enough for application to video sequences. The power of the technique is in its ability to carry out detection even in the presence of cluttered backgrounds and partial occlusion. The developed methods have been integrated within software packages for the analysis of powertrain drivebelts by Pixoft Ltd and used by engineers at DAF Trucks NV in Holland, Ford Turkey, and Nissan in Japan (contact Jimmy Robinson, MD of Pixoft Ltd, info@pixoft.co.uk).
